Pepper and The Quiet Yes
Tuesdays are loud—too loud for Carlos.
Pepper loves noise, playing loud, and making friends fast. Carlos loves quiet, order, and lining up things just right. When Pepper’s cheerful hello is met with silence, she feels hurt and confused. But with patience, kindness, and a little learning, Pepper discovers that not everyone says yes the same way.
Through shared fun at recess, fallen block towers, and a quiet break from a booming school fair, Pepper begins to understand her new friend. Carlos may not use many words, but he listens deeply, remembers everything, and shows his care in his own beautiful way.
This gentle, affirming story introduces young readers to friendship, empathy, and neurodiversity—showing that some friends are loud, some are quiet, and some teach us how to truly listen.
